Output 6535331556e36efade88aa32e8e7ac0e199e22f7364f8ed3314ed906b76dff63:3

value
17365430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6959c7ef9cbb42fdb88e198d1e50eb3b72d1b68 OP_EQUAL
address
3NiEZqjKPSaUh4EjLMGL343Sc2dRvYkgiM
transaction
6535331556e36efade88aa32e8e7ac0e199e22f7364f8ed3314ed906b76dff63
spent
true